Il d\u00e9termine la rapidit\u00e9 avec laquelle vous acc\u00e9l\u00e9rez, la facilit\u00e9 avec laquelle vous grimpez les c\u00f4tes et la r\u00e9activit\u00e9 de votre moto dans les embouteillages. Lorsque l'on compare les motos \u00e9lectriques et les motos \u00e0 essence, le couple d\u00e9livr\u00e9 est la principale diff\u00e9rence - les moteurs \u00e9lectriques d\u00e9livrent un couple maximal instantan\u00e9ment \u00e0 0 tr\/min, alors que les moteurs \u00e0 essence doivent monter en r\u00e9gime. Dans le cas des motos, il s'agit de la force motrice produite par le vilebrequin, g\u00e9n\u00e9ralement mesur\u00e9e en newtons-m\u00e8tres (N-m) ou en kilogrammes-m\u00e8tres (kg-m). Elle refl\u00e8te la capacit\u00e9 du moteur \u00e0 propulser la moto vers l'avant.<\/p><p>Il s'agit de la \u201cforce de pouss\u00e9e\u201d lorsque vous tournez l'acc\u00e9l\u00e9rateur. Le couple est faible au ralenti, il augmente jusqu'\u00e0 atteindre un pic dans la plage des r\u00e9gimes moyens \u00e0 \u00e9lev\u00e9s, puis diminue. Par exemple, une moto sportive typique de 250 cm3 (Yamaha R3) produit 29 N-m \u00e0 9 000 tr\/min (vilebrequin). Ces moteurs sont plus faciles \u00e0 contr\u00f4ler et conviennent \u00e0 la conduite quotidienne et au tourisme de longue dur\u00e9e.<\/li><li><strong>Courbe de couple raide :<\/strong> Le moteur produit un couple maximal \u00e0 haut r\u00e9gime. Ces moteurs ont g\u00e9n\u00e9ralement un potentiel de performance plus \u00e9lev\u00e9 mais sont plus difficiles \u00e0 utiliser, ce qui les rend adapt\u00e9s \u00e0 la conduite sur circuit ou aux amateurs de performances.<\/li><\/ul><\/div>\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-7b4575cf elementor-widget elementor-widget-spacer\" data-id=\"7b4575cf\" data-element_type=\"widget\" data-e-type=\"widget\" data-widget_type=\"spacer.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t<div class=\"elementor-spacer\">\n\t\t\t<div class=\"elementor-spacer-inner\"><\/div>\n\t\t<\/div>\n\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-4391102 elementor-widget elementor-widget-image\" data-id=\"4391102\" data-element_type=\"widget\" data-e-type=\"widget\" data-widget_type=\"image.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t\t\t\t\t\t\t<img loading=\"lazy\" decoding=\"async\" width=\"1200\" height=\"600\" src=\"https:\/\/batteryswapstation.com\/wp-content\/uploads\/2025\/08\/The-Relationship-Between-Power-and-Torque.webp\" class=\"attachment-full size-full wp-image-38142\" alt=\"La relation entre la puissance et le couple\" title=\"\" \/>\t\t\t\t\t\t\t\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-c5eadb0 elementor-widget elementor-widget-spacer\" data-id=\"c5eadb0\" data-element_type=\"widget\" data-e-type=\"widget\" data-widget_type=\"spacer.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t<div class=\"elementor-spacer\">\n\t\t\t<div class=\"elementor-spacer-inner\"><\/div>\n\t\t<\/div>\n\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-15511ae elementor-widget elementor-widget-heading\" data-id=\"15511ae\" data-element_type=\"widget\" data-e-type=\"widget\" data-widget_type=\"heading.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t<h2 class=\"elementor-heading-title elementor-size-default\">T\u00eate-\u00e0-t\u00eate : \u00e9lectricit\u00e9 vs gaz (scientifiquement comparables)<\/h2>\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-28a43757 elementor-widget elementor-widget-spacer\" data-id=\"28a43757\" data-element_type=\"widget\" data-e-type=\"widget\" data-widget_type=\"spacer.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t<div class=\"elementor-spacer\">\n\t\t\t<div class=\"elementor-spacer-inner\"><\/div>\n\t\t<\/div>\n\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-ae106db elementor-widget elementor-widget-text-editor\" data-id=\"ae106db\" data-element_type=\"widget\" data-e-type=\"widget\" data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t<div style=\"line-height: 40px;\">Pour vous aider \u00e0 voir la diff\u00e9rence, voici une comparaison entre une moto ordinaire de 250 cm3 \u00e0 essence et notre moto \u00e9lectrique E67 (essais au banc d'essai interne, juillet 2025).<\/div>\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-8081dea elementor-widget elementor-widget-text-editor\" data-id=\"8081dea\" data-element_type=\"widget\" data-e-type=\"widget\" data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t<div style=\"overflow-x: auto;\">\n<table style=\"width: 100%; L'acc\u00e9l\u00e9ration d\u00e9pend du rapport poids\/puissance et de la forme de la courbe de couple, et pas seulement du couple maximal. Un cruiser lourd avec un pic de couple \u00e9lev\u00e9 \u00e0 bas r\u00e9gime peut encore acc\u00e9l\u00e9rer plus lentement qu'une moto sportive l\u00e9g\u00e8re avec moins de couple mais plus de puissance \u00e0 haut r\u00e9gime.
